Subject: Pickup — pallet of recalled chargers

Dispatch desk,

The recalled Voltique chargers are consolidated on one shrink-wrapped pallet at the loading bay of the Greely Park office. The recall paperwork is taped to the top carton and the pallet is tagged DO NOT RESELL. Pickup is needed by Wednesday close of business. Please ensure the driver follows the hand-over instruction below.

courier memo of yawep-yafog: the pramir ulaix courier leaves the ulavan aldix frair zorok oliiel joreth rusdor fenvan ledger at gate 1305 under passcode 514738

- [ ] **Step 7: Breaker override escrow.** After sealing the signing keys for the Tallgrove upstream API circuit breaker, confirm the support team can force the breaker open during a full outage. The override bundle lives in the sealed escrow drawer and is useless without its unlock phrase. Two ceremony witnesses must initial this step before proceeding. The escrow bundle is decrypted with the recovery passphrase that follows.

vault phrase of kahip-kahop = holath-quenmir

Dorit — the printed labels for the Skellerby Maritime Gallery are packed in two flat folios, acid-free sleeves, corners padded. Order within each folio matters, so please mark them DO NOT RESHUFFLE. They go out on tomorrow's first run to the Aldmere Annexe. Give the courier the following instruction word for word at hand-over.

dispatch memo: the lamwyn fenwyn courier leaves the wenir ledger at gate 7175 under passcode 822969

Handover for review — SyncLoom calendar service. The conflict you're reviewing stems from double-applied updates: when the Meridian connector and our webhook both touch an event within the dedupe window, last-writer-wins drops attendee changes. My patch adds a vector-clock check before merge; please scrutinize the tombstone handling in merge_events.go, as it's the riskiest path. For reference, the staging environment ran with the configuration values below.

deployment values, yadug-bawif:
[framir]
team = pelox
access_code = ac_a38ab2
owner = tamion.julael
host = framir.tolvaqlabs.test
port = 11211
peer = tammir.zemvargrid.local
salt = 2215ef03
pin = 1541